
This study introduces a novel protocol combining artificial intelligence (AI) and mixed reality (MR) for implant surgical planning. Using intraoral scanning and cone beam computed tomography, AI automatically aligns and segments patient 3D models. MR software enables holographic surgical planning, guiding the creation of 3D-printed surgical guides for static computer-assisted implant surgery (s-CAIS). Initial results indicate reliable implant positioning in simple cases, suggesting potential for wider clinical application.
